## Releases

Poolhand (connection pooler for the Bramble stack) releases monthly. Tags follow `vX.Y.Z`. Pull artifacts from the internal registry only — never rebuild from source for production. Verify every artifact signature before deploy; unsigned binaries are rejected by the Kestrel gateway anyway. Verify against the release signing key below.

rollout seal: bky4_x7Gc

**Ticket: Weather-alert fan-out duplicating pushes**

Summary: When the Stormline gateway receives a county-wide advisory, the fan-out worker enqueues one job per subscriber segment, but a retry race causes some segments to be enqueued twice, so users near Halwick Ridge received duplicate alerts. Proposed fix adds an idempotency check keyed on advisory revision. Fix verified on staging under sustained load. The candidate build for release sign-off is identified below.

session token of kageg-tahop = htk14_af3c1ccccb7dcf

Runbook: digest scheduler recovery (Mailloom). If the nightly digest batch stalls, first confirm the cron worker on the scheduler node is alive, then verify DIGEST_WINDOW matches the tenant's timezone. After any restart, the worker re-reads its environment file in full, so confirm the SMTP relay credential is present. It is set by the single line immediately below this paragraph.

vault entry, yahif-yajep: COURIER_KEY29=b802bdf8034096b65a51c6ba5abe2

Handover note — Crumbwheel order cutoffs.

Welcome aboard. The bakery cutoff rule in Crumbwheel closes same-day orders at 14:00 local to each storefront, not UTC — this has bitten us twice. Holiday overrides live in the calendar service and take precedence silently, so always check there first when a cutoff looks wrong. To unlock the calendar service's admin console after a restart, enter the recovery passphrase below.

vault phrase of bagap-bahaf = silion-pelox-sorox-casdor-quenwyn-fraax-eliox-praael-kelion-quenvan-kasox-rusael-norius-belvan

Subject: Handover — Coldpath release signing

Hi,

Before you review the Coldpath changes, note that our serverless handlers now pre-warm via the Fennick scheduler, cutting cold starts roughly in half. The warm-pool config ships with each release bundle, so every deploy must be signed or the scheduler rejects it. Please verify signatures against the key below.

signing key of baduf-kafog = bky6_Azw6Lf